Communication skills: Communication is crucial for business because it helps organizations succeed and work effectively, and it is thus an important skill for criminal lawyers to have. Individuals who opt for a career as a Criminal Lawyer must be able to communicate orally and in writing, but they must be effective listeners as well. The job of a Criminal Lawyer in a court proceeding is to argue persuasively in front of the jury and judges in the courtroom, so great communication skills are essential.
Research skills: Criminal lawyers must conduct research into relevant evidence. To win every case, one must be aware of the actual evidence claimed. Criminal lawyers must do fast and accurate research to learn about their clients and their needs in order to establish legal strategies. Criminal lawyers must process and comprehend a huge amount of information before filtering it down into something useful when preparing legal schemes.
Judgment skills: Criminal lawyers must be able to make logical, factual conclusions or judgments based on the limited information available to them. Criminal lawyers must be able to objectively evaluate these decisions in order to spot possible points of vulnerability in their client’s case that must be addressed. Criminal lawyers are often confronted with cases in which they must make several critical judgment decisions in a short amount of time. To excel and succeed in their respective situations, they must have good judgment skills.
People skills: Criminal Lawyers must be presentable, influential, and able to read others. This enables Criminal Lawyers to assess the jury’s responses as well as the reliability of witnesses. Being approachable enables Criminal Lawyers to determine the appropriate course of action to obtain the desired result: either the client following a lawyer’s advice or making a favorable settlement with the opposition.
